Abstract
The effect of temperature on kinetic and equilibrium parameters of ure a hydrolysis catalyzed with urease immobilized into a thermosensitive poly-N-isopropylacrylamide gel was studied. The temperature behavior o f the gel-urease system is different from similar systems. After a dec rease in the enzyme activity above the critical temperature, the maxim al rate of the enzymatic reaction and gel swelling ratio begin to incr ease. Urea hydrolysis catalyzed with immobilized urease and shrinking- swelling of the thermosensitive urease-containing gel depend on each o ther. Under collapse, gel swelling ratio increases due to the enzymati c reaction. The rate of the enzymatic reaction no longer follows Micha elis-Menten kinetics, and the dependence of the reaction rate on subst rate concentration becomes more complicated.
